- The discipline of Public Administration is ethno-centric while CPA is cross-cultural in its orientation. I.e. The scholars of CPA were trying to understand the working of public administration across various nations.
- There they tried to study the traditional aspects of the government – weberian structures.
- Public Administration is practitioner oriented whereas, CPA attempts to build a theory and seeks ‘knowledge for the sake of knowledge’.
